Application Scenario:
In the aerospace industry, XCVU5P-L2FLVA2104E plays a crucial role in radar and communication systems aboard satellites and spacecraft.
Circuit Design:
To integrate XCVU5P-L2FLVA2104E into a radar system for aerospace applications, follow these steps:
1. Signal Processing:
Utilize the high-speed DSP slices and extensive memory resources of XCVU5P-L2FLVA2104E to implement sophisticated signal processing algorithms for radar data processing, including target detection, tracking, and imaging.
2. Communication Interface:
Implement high-speed serial interfaces, such as Gigabit Ethernet or PCIe, to facilitate data communication between XCVU5P-L2FLVA2104E and other onboard systems or ground stations. Configure the appropriate transceivers and protocol stacks for reliable data transmission.
3. Radiation Hardening:
Design the circuitry and layout to withstand the harsh radiation environment of space. Implement radiation-hardened components and shielding techniques to ensure the reliability and longevity of XCVU5P-L2FLVA2104E in orbit.
4. Power Management:
Implement efficient power management circuitry to supply XCVU5P-L2FLVA2104E and associated peripherals with stable and clean power sources. Utilize low-dropout regulators and filtering capacitors to minimize noise and voltage fluctuations.
5. Testing and Verification:
Conduct comprehensive testing and verification procedures to validate the performance, reliability, and radiation tolerance of the radar system incorporating XCVU5P-L2FLVA2104E. Perform environmental testing, such as thermal vacuum testing, to ensure proper operation in space conditions.
Considerations:
When designing the radar system, consider the following factors:
- High-Speed Data Processing: Utilize the FPGA's parallel processing capabilities to handle large volumes of radar data in real-time.
- Fault Tolerance: Implement error detection and correction mechanisms to mitigate the effects of radiation-induced single-event upsets (SEUs) on XCVU5P-L2FLVA2104E and ensure mission continuity.
- Thermal Management: Design effective thermal management solutions to dissipate heat generated by the FPGA and other components to maintain optimal operating temperatures.
- Compliance with Space Standards: Ensure compliance with relevant space standards and regulations for electronic components and systems, including NASA's Space Plug-and-Play Avionics (SPA) standards and MIL-STD-883.
- Scalability and Future Expansion: Design the radar system with scalability in mind to accommodate future upgrades and enhancements, such as additional sensor inputs or processing capabilities.
